Price $3The fried kway tiao here is rather fragrant as it has the wok fragrance after being fried in it. The taste still maintains after the last time I had tried it. It was quite oily though which may deter those who are health-conscious - definitely not a healthier choice or something that is good for the body but eating this once in a while is quite shiok! The ingredients in it are the typical char kway tiao ingredients such as hum, chinese sausage, beansprouts and more.
